As you Asking for the Solved Question Paper of the SSC CHSL Reasoning the Solved Question Paper is given below Reasoning QID : 1 - Select the related word/letters/number from the given alternatives. Mughals : History : : Rivers : ? Options: 1) Geography 2) Physics 3) Psychology 4) Biology Correct Answer: Geography QID : 2 - Select the related word/letters/number from the given alternatives. ADH : ILP : : GJN : ? Options: 1) OVR 2) ORV 3) PVR 4) PWR Correct Answer: ORV QID : 3 - Select the related word/letters/number from the given alternatives. WD : TF : : TG : ? Options: 1) QR 2) QI 3) IQ 4) IP Correct Answer: QI QID : 4 - Select the related word/letters/number from the given alternatives. 9 : 27 : : 64 : ? Options: 1) 225 2) 216 3) 512 4) 324 Correct Answer: 512 QID : 5 - Select the odd word/letters/number/number pair from the given alternatives. Options: 1) Igloo 2) Den 3) Stables 4) Rock Correct Answer: Rock QID : 6 - Select the odd word/letters/number/number pair from the given alternatives. Options: 1) CUD 2) SIP 3) SET 4) NTR Correct Answer: NTR QID : 7 - Select the odd word/letters/number/number pair from the given alternatives. Options: 1) 132 2) 145 3) 187 4) 144 Correct Answer: 144 QID : 8 - Select the odd word/letters/number/number pair from the given alternatives. Options: 1) 361 2) 289 3) 225 4) 216 Correct Answer: 216 QID : 9 - A series is given with one term missing. Select the correct alternative from the given ones that will complete the series. Ace, King, Queen, ? Options: 1) Jack 2) Club 3) Heart 4) Diamond Correct Answer: Jack QID : 10 - A series is given with one term missing. Select the correct alternative from the given ones that will complete the series. BB, DZ, GW, KS, ? Options: 1) IK 2) IG 3) PN 4) PS Correct Answer: PN QID : 11 - A series is given with one term missing. Select the correct alternative from the given ones that will complete the series. HI, MN, RS, ? Options: 1) XY 2) WX 3) WY 4) WE Correct Answer: WX QID : 12 - A series is given with one term missing. Select the correct alternative from the given ones that will complete the series. 80, 130, 190, 260, ? Options: 1) 350 2) 340 3) 300 4) 320 Correct Answer: 340 QID : 13 - In the following question, two statements are given each followed by two conclusions I and II. You have to consider the statements to be true even if they seem to be at variance from commonly known facts. You have to decide which of the given conclusions, if any, follows from the given statements. Statement: (I) Kids rejoice with toys and toys give them new opportunities to think in various ways. (II) Toys are non-living things that create a virtual world around kids to think and perceive in various ways. Conclusions: (I) If children don't play with toys some part of the personality is underdeveloped. (II) Toys are mandatory and undetachable part of their personality. Options: 1) Only conclusion II follows 2) Conclusion I and II both follow 3) Neither I nor II follow 4) Only conclusion I follows Correct Answer: Neither I nor II follow QID : 14 - Five students P, Q, R, S and T are sitting on a bench. Q is to the left of P and right of T. S is at the extreme right end and R is to the left of S. Who is sitting third from the left? Options: 1) P 2) Q 3) R 4) T Correct Answer: P QID : 15 - Arrange the given words in the sequence in which they occur in the dictionary. i. Temerity ii. Temporary iii. Tempered iv. Temperature Options: 1) i, iv, iii, ii 2) iii, ii, iv, i 3) i, ii, iii, iv 4) iv, iii, i, ii Correct Answer: i, iv, iii, ii QID : 16 - In a certain code language, "DONKEY" is written as "YEKNOD".
